WebMar 29, 2024 · Here are some pictures to accompany the podcast. "The Dying Gaul," Roman marble copy of a 3rd c. BC Greek bronze (Capitoline museum, Rome) He's wearing a metal "torc" around his neck and had his hair dyed white with lime. He's collapsed after battle, his sword and war trumpet by his side. WebDying warrior (5.24) holds a shield which is important in forming the tallest part of the triangle in the pediment design. The other sculpture (5.23) uses the head as the highest point of the triangle shape. Both of the images are idealistic in form because they are posed in the nude. Greek warriors wore clothes when they participated in battle. WebThe sculptures are Roman copies of Greek bronze originals created in the third century BC to commemorate the victory of the king of Pergamon over the Gauls. WebAug 24, 2024 · What is the dying warrior? This “Dying Warrior” is a Pediment Sculpture from the Temple of Aphaia. It is believed to represent a fallen Trojan hero, probably Laomedon. It was initially part of the east pediment of the Temple of Aphaia, created about 505–500 BC. The Greeks idolize heroes who had fallen in war. WebJul 15, 2016 · Photo: DEA / G.
